Great Britain, represented by the British Olympic Association (BOA), competed at the 1936 Summer Olympics in Berlin, …The Third Reich Chancellor Adolf Hitler officially opened the Olympic Games in 1936 at the 100,000-seat Olympic stadium.; Spain did not take part in the Games because of their Civil War.; For the first time, the international community saw the Torch Relay, in which a flaming torch from Olympia, Greece traveled through seven countries to Berlin for the Opening …A controversial move at the Games was the benching of two American Jewish runners, Marty Glickman and Sam Stoller. Both had trained for the 4x100-meter relay, but on the day before the event, they were replaced by Jesse Owens and Ralph Metcalfe, the team's two fastest sprinters. Various reasons were given for the change.

Berlin had been selected to host the 1936 Olympic Games before the Nazis came to power, but the regime took full advantage of the enormous propaganda opportunity the Games presented. The Nazi regime hoped to portray Germany as a tolerant and hospitable nation. Violence was suppressed, anti-Jewish signs were temporarily removed and the fiercely ... Basketball at the 1936 Summer Olympics was the first appearance of the sport of basketball as an official Olympic medal event. The tournament was played between 7 August and 14 August 1936 in Berlin, Germany. 23 nations entered the competition, making basketball the largest tournament of the team sports, but Hungary and Spain withdrew ...Jul 23, 2021 ... Rowing at the 1936 Summer Olympics featured seven events, for men only. The competitions were held from 11 to 14 August on a regatta course at Grünau on the Langer See. [1] The competition was dominated by the hosts, Germany, who medaled in every event and took five of the seven gold medals. The final race, men's eights, was won by a ... Athletics at the 1936 Summer Olympics – Women's 4 × 100 metres relay. The women's 4 × 100 metres relay event at the 1936 Olympic Games took place on August 8 and August 9. [1] The American team won with a time of 46.9 s after the German team, which had been in the lead, dropped the baton on the final leg.

The 1936 Summer Olympics torch relay was the first of its kind, following on from the reintroduction of the Olympic Flame at the 1928 Games. It pioneered the modern convention of moving the flame via a relay system from Greece to the Olympic venue. It’s often reported that kabaddi was a demonstration sport for the 1936 Olympics but the fact is that it was never an official part of the Games. The sport was, in fact, showcased in Berlin as an exhibition performance just prior to the Summer Games. However, it was enough to give kabaddi the international exposure it needed to start …

The women's 400 metre freestyle was a swimming event held as part of the swimming at the 1936 Summer Olympics programme. [1] It was the fourth appearance of the event, which was established in 1924 after 1920 a 300 metre event was held. The competition was held from Thursday to Saturday, 13 to 15 August 1936.

People's Olympiad. Purpose. Alternative sporting event to protest against the 1936 Summer Olympics being held in Berlin under Nazi rule. The People's Olympiad ( Catalan: Olimpíada Popular, Spanish: Olimpiada Popular) was a planned international multi-sport event that was intended to take place in Barcelona, Catalonia within the Spanish Republic.
